Output 6c877eaa4d8d3c1924935ed250cdf2990fa88dcb3f39f2f7b7f7fc0903284017:0

value
10862570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e2a9d307bfb83d035c51dd7961d0f74aff635b OP_EQUAL
address
3MToQptxZ87aNn9qYDEmUPnW2jL9ehCeYV
transaction
6c877eaa4d8d3c1924935ed250cdf2990fa88dcb3f39f2f7b7f7fc0903284017
spent
true